Decoding Emotions: AI's Journey into the Realm of Feeling
The realm of human emotions has long been a enigma for researchers. Historically, understanding feelings relied on subjective interpretations and complex psychological study. But now, artificial intelligence (AI) is embarking on a intriguing journey to translate these subjective states.
Advanced AI algorithms are utilized to analyze vast collections of human behavior, hunting for patterns that correspond with specific emotions. Through neural networks, these AI platforms are acquiring to identify subtle indicators in facial expressions, voice tone, and even textual communication.
- Eventually, this transformative technology has the capability to alter the way we interpret emotions, providing valuable insights in fields such as mental health, teaching, and even customer service.
The Human Touch: Where AI Falls Short in Emotional Intelligence
While artificial intelligence rapidly a staggering pace, there remains a crucial area where it falls short: emotional intelligence. AI algorithms struggle to truly grasp the complexities of human sentiment. They are devoid of the capacity for empathy, compassion, and intuition that are crucial for navigating social dynamics. AI may be able to process facial expressions and pitch in voice, but it lacks the ability to authentically feel what lies beneath the surface. This intrinsic difference highlights the enduring value of human connection and the irreplaceable influence that emotions have in shaping our experiences.
